As for the scanning tips, I remember the 4 golden rules Cendres taught me a few years ago, they're still very good imho:

1) scan at 200 dpi, putting a black sheet under the page you're scanning [so that the back of the page doesn't show up in the scan]
2) open the image in your image-retouching program, and apply a softening filter [in my old version of PSP, I use the "Soften" or "Blur" filter]
3) reduce the image [generally, setting 800 pixels width is fine 4 me]
4) slightly modify brightness/contrast to make the image look better [I usually decrease brightness a bit, and increase contrast a bit at the same time]

Just open up the imageshack site, then click the "browse" botton, find the pic you want to upload from your computer, than click "open" and then again "host it!". And it's done, after that you get the codes to post the uploaded image (to make a clickable thumbnail for this forum, copy the code from the 2nd field and paste it in the message body here).
